Topics Covered
- Data Management and Analytics: Focuses on the collection, storage, and analysis of hydrological and water resource data.: Geographic Information Systems (GIS): Teaches the use of GIS for spatial data analysis and decision-making in water resource management.
- Remote Sensing and Monitoring: Introduces the use of remote sensing technologies for monitoring water resources and environmental changes.: Hydrological Modelling: Covers the development and application of models to simulate water cycle processes and predict water availability.
- Water Resource Planning and Management: Explores strategies and techniques for sustainable water resource planning and management.: Smart Water Systems: Discusses the integration of digital technologies to improve water system efficiency and sustainability.
